Output d0f32dae2e113370526f69d7665ffda76e4553e9155bb7ec538581d13ed6504d:1

value
495865077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b338ce68099419306ed36dc41577ed2d3e3fc6 OP_EQUAL
address
3JM3c1hETAWRoDLycXoK9K1RPXvuiuBRwL
transaction
d0f32dae2e113370526f69d7665ffda76e4553e9155bb7ec538581d13ed6504d
spent
true